Can I Use an EIDE Boat Loader with the Adarac Pro # A4000955 on My 2011 Ford F-250?
Question:
I need to know if this adarac will allow the use of an EIDE boat loader mounted to it and still clear the cab with a small boat on it?
asked by: JB
Helpful Expert Reply:
As far as the compatibility of an automatic EIDE boat loader with the Adarac Pro Series # A4000955, we have not tested the mechanics of the loader with the Adarac. We also unfortunately do not have the specs/measurements of the EIDE boat loader because it is not a product that we carry.
As far as the height of the Adarac system on your truck, I confirmed with the manufacturer that the ladder rack adds 24 inches of height from the top of your truck bed's cap rails to the top of the crossbar. In order to make sure that your boat clears the cab, I recommend measuring comparing your cab's height when measured from the cap rails.
